带onclick功能的跳转菜单
Jump menu with onclick function
我想将 link 与 onclick 事件集成到 <a href="#" onclick="fireMarker(1);">Map Marker URL 1</a>
和 <a href="#" onclick="fireMarker(2);">Map Marker URL 2</a>
之类的功能中,并集成到
之类的跳转菜单中
<select id="selectbox" name="" onchange="javascript:location.href = this.value;">
<option value="https://www.yahoo.com/" selected>Option1</option>
<option value="https://www.google.co.in/">Option2</option>
<option value="https://www.gmail.com/">Option3</option>
</select>
或
<select onchange="fireMarker(this);">
<option value="15">1</option>
<option value="16">2</option>
<option value="18">3</option>
</select>
fireMarker 函数是:
function fireMarker(id){
google.maps.event.trigger(markers[id], 'click');
markers[id].setAnimation(google.maps.Animation.DROP);
markers[id].setVisible(true);
}
当我单击一个选项时,我希望它以地图标记 URL 格式执行 url。
希望同一个页面有多个跳转菜单
谢谢
将 onchange="fireMarker(this); 替换为 onchange="fireMarker(value)"
喜欢:
<html>
<head>
<script type="text/javascript">
function fireMarker(id) {
google.maps.event.trigger(markers[id], 'click');
markers[id].setAnimation(google.maps.Animation.DROP);
markers[id].setVisible(true);
}
</script>
</head>
<body>
<select onchange="fireMarker(value)">
<option value="15">1</option>
<option value="16">2</option>
<option value="18">3</option>
</select>
</body>
我想将 link 与 onclick 事件集成到 <a href="#" onclick="fireMarker(1);">Map Marker URL 1</a>
和 <a href="#" onclick="fireMarker(2);">Map Marker URL 2</a>
之类的功能中,并集成到
<select id="selectbox" name="" onchange="javascript:location.href = this.value;">
<option value="https://www.yahoo.com/" selected>Option1</option>
<option value="https://www.google.co.in/">Option2</option>
<option value="https://www.gmail.com/">Option3</option>
</select>
或
<select onchange="fireMarker(this);">
<option value="15">1</option>
<option value="16">2</option>
<option value="18">3</option>
</select>
fireMarker 函数是:
function fireMarker(id){
google.maps.event.trigger(markers[id], 'click');
markers[id].setAnimation(google.maps.Animation.DROP);
markers[id].setVisible(true);
}
当我单击一个选项时,我希望它以地图标记 URL 格式执行 url。 希望同一个页面有多个跳转菜单 谢谢
将 onchange="fireMarker(this); 替换为 onchange="fireMarker(value)"
喜欢:
<html>
<head>
<script type="text/javascript">
function fireMarker(id) {
google.maps.event.trigger(markers[id], 'click');
markers[id].setAnimation(google.maps.Animation.DROP);
markers[id].setVisible(true);
}
</script>
</head>
<body>
<select onchange="fireMarker(value)">
<option value="15">1</option>
<option value="16">2</option>
<option value="18">3</option>
</select>
</body>